  • Question
  • Carrier is


  • Options
  • A. One or more conductors that serve as a common connection for a related group of devices
  • B. a continuous frequency capable of being modulated or impressed with a second signal
  • C. the condition when two or more sections attempt to use the same channel at the same time
  • D. a collection of interconnected functional units that provides a data communications service among stations attached to the network
  • E. None of the above

  • Correct Answer
  • a continuous frequency capable of being modulated or impressed with a second signal
